2020 Round 2 Game 7 @ Avalanche
2020 saw one of the greatest playoff runs in team history but it ended just a little short. Two powerhouse teams faced off in a winner-take-all Game 7 in the Edmonton Bubble. This game was a wild affair with multiple lead changes. It was 1-0 Stars then 2-1 Avalanche. The Stars tied the game late in the 3rd period 3-3 but Vladislav Namestnikov of the Avalanche appeared to score the series-winner with 3:40 remaining.
Stars fans wanted to crawl up into fetal position on that one. Joel Kiviranta became the savior 10 seconds later with the tying goal. Kiviranta cemented himself in the lore of Stars history with the overtime-winner and hat trick. This game is important because the Stars made it to the Western Conference Final for the first time since 2008 on a crazy 5-4 game.
2020 Western Conference Final Game 5 @ Las Vegas
2020 was an important year in the history of the Stars. Their Stanley Cup Final run was something this fanbase needed. Game 5 against the Vegas Golden Knights was one that is replayed over and over again with Stars fans. The Golden Knights made the score 2-0 while in the 3rd period but the Stars stormed back to force overtime. Denis Gurianov teed one up on the powerplay in overtime to send the Stars to the Stanley Cup Final for the first time since 2000.
1999 Stanley Cup Final Game 6 @ Buffalo
This is the game that every Stars fan considers the ultimate one. The Dallas Stars became Stanley Cup Champions in the wee hours of a June 20th Buffalo morning on a game that started on the previous day. Craig Ludwig got an assist in the final game of his career. This game is most remembered by Stars fans as the one that won it all. It took 3 overtime periods before Brett Hull’s controversial goal gave Dallas their first and only Stanley Cup to date.
